New Service Launched:   Book Match!

To use the free service, patrons simply answer a few quick questions on an online form on the library system’s website about preferred reading formats, a description of recently enjoyed books, genres/books you do not want to read, and more.  Library staff will search to compile a list of suggested reads within a few days and send the patron a personalized email curated with a list of books.
